Who Nicola Benedetti is and why people search her net worth

Violinist silhouette performing in a softly lit concert hall with warm stage lights

Nicola Benedetti is a Scottish violinist widely regarded as one of the most prominent classical soloists working today. Born in 1987 in West Kilbride, Scotland, she rose to public attention after winning the BBC Young Musician of the Year competition in 2004 at age 16. Since then she has built a career spanning solo recitals, concerto appearances with major orchestras (the Boston Symphony Orchestra, the Hallé, the BBC Symphony Orchestra, and many others), a Grammy Award, multiple chart-topping albums, and a growing institutional footprint as an educator and festival director.

The reason people search her net worth is straightforward: she occupies an unusual position in classical music where genuine mainstream visibility meets serious institutional power. In March 2022 she was named Director Designate of the Edinburgh International Festival, formally taking the role of Festival Director on 1 October 2022, making her one of the most senior figures in European arts leadership. She has also received the Queen's Medal for Music (2017, as the youngest-ever recipient), an MBE in 2013, and a CBE in 2019. A Grammy win in January 2020 for Best Classical Instrumental Solo (for the Wynton Marsalis Violin Concerto and Fiddle Dance Suite recording on Decca) pushed her profile further into global territory. Where her income actually comes from

Concert fees and touring

This is the biggest driver. Benedetti performs regularly with top-tier orchestras globally. The Strad documented her U.S. "Benedetti Sessions" with the St. Louis Symphony Orchestra, which included seven or eight performances, two of which were on tour. A Japan tour with the BBC Symphony Orchestra is also on record. At elite-soloist fee levels, a single season of 40 to 60 engagements can generate gross performance income well into the seven figures before expenses. The Benedetti Baroque Orchestra, which she leads as Director, adds another layer of income from residencies and festival appearances.

Recording royalties and Decca deal

Violin and music stand beside a studio microphone with generic records, suggesting recording label royalties.

Benedetti has recorded exclusively for Decca Classics (part of Universal Music) for most of her career, and that relationship is ongoing. Classical recording advances are generally lower than pop, but Decca is the premium classical label globally, and a long-term exclusive deal at her profile level typically includes guaranteed recording budgets, marketing support, and royalty rates that compound over a back catalogue. Her 2012 album "The Silver Violin" topped Amazon music charts, outperforming peers across genres. The Grammy-winning Marsalis album from 2020 would have extended the commercial life of that recording significantly. Royalty income from a catalogue of this size and quality is a steady, if not spectacular, contributor to net worth over time.

Assets, lifestyle, and what can drag the number down

Open luxury violin case with bow and premium travel accessories in a hotel room corner under natural light.

One factor worth flagging is the Gariel Stradivarius violin, which Benedetti has played since 2012. Stradivarius instruments typically carry valuations in the $1 million to $5 million range, but violinists at her level often play instruments on loan from foundations or private collectors rather than owning them outright. If the Gariel is a loan, it does not appear on her personal balance sheet. If she owns it, it is a significant illiquid asset. The public record does not clarify ownership, so it is prudent not to include it in a base-case net worth estimate.

Touring is also genuinely expensive. Travel, accommodation, a management team, accompanists, insurance, and agent commissions typically consume 30 to 50 percent of gross performance income for a soloist at this level. That gap between gross fees and net take-home is one reason why an artist with impressive headline earnings can still have a more modest net worth than people expect. How her wealth has shifted over time

Minimal desk scene with blank calendar cards and studio gear, symbolizing career milestones over time.

Benedetti's career has had several clear inflection points that would have moved her net worth upward.

  1. 2004: BBC Young Musician win. This launched her professional career and led directly to her Decca deal. The foundation of all subsequent earnings starts here.
  2. 2012: 'The Silver Violin' tops Amazon charts. A rare mainstream crossover moment for a classical album, this would have triggered stronger royalty flows and renegotiated contract terms.
  3. 2013 and 2019: MBE and CBE honors. These do not pay money, but they elevate her commercial and institutional standing, directly supporting higher fees and endorsement value.
  4. 2017: Queen's Medal for Music as youngest-ever recipient. Another visibility milestone that raised her profile in the U.S. and international markets.
  5. January 2020: Grammy Award for Best Classical Instrumental Solo (Marsalis Violin Concerto, Decca). Grammy wins have a documented effect on streaming and album sales, and the association with Wynton Marsalis opened doors in the U.S. market specifically.
  6. October 2022: Becomes Director of the Edinburgh International Festival. This adds a senior institutional salary and dramatically raises her public profile in arts leadership, likely increasing masterclass, speaking, and advisory income alongside the direct salary.
  7. Ongoing: Benedetti Sessions expansion to the U.S. (St. Louis Symphony Orchestra). Internationalizing her education and performance brand increases both fee potential and long-term institutional relevance.
